In Northeast Ohio suburbs like Lyndhurst, testing soil pH and nutrient levels is crucial to supporting healthy grass growth, but there’s more to consider. Soil in this region often contains clay, which can lead to compaction, and sun exposure varies widely depending on the presence of mature trees.

An often-overlooked factor is the balance of sunlight across your yard. Lawns with too much direct sunlight can experience elevated soil temperatures, leading to dryness and stressed grass. Conversely, heavily shaded areas—common in neighborhoods with older trees—may struggle with moss or thinning grass. While a thin layer of thatch can be beneficial—helping to retain moisture and protect the soil—excessive thatch becomes a barrier. It prevents water, air, and nutrients from reaching the roots, which weakens the grass and leaves it more vulnerable to pests, diseases, and drought. Proper thatch management is essential to maintaining a healthy, resilient lawn that can thrive year-round.
At Colin Can Help, we manage thatch by inspecting its thickness, using tools like dethatching rakes or power equipment to remove excess buildup, and aerating the lawn to improve decomposition naturally. This process involves using specialized equipment to pull small cores, or plugs, of soil from your lawn. Removing these plugs breaks up compaction and creates pathways for water, air, and nutrients to penetrate deep into the root zone, where they’re needed most.

Clay-rich soil in particular benefits greatly from aeration, as it tends to compact more easily, restricting root growth and causing drainage issues. By pulling these cores, we not only improve soil structure but also make it easier for grass roots to grow deeper and stronger. The result? Healthier, more resilient grass that can better withstand drought, heat, and everyday use. In areas like Lyndhurst, where clay-heavy soil can hinder root growth and drainage, organic materials work wonders by improving soil structure and creating better pathways for water and nutrients.

Compost enhances microbial activity in the soil, helping break down nutrients and making them more readily available to grass roots. It also increases the soil’s ability to retain moisture, which is especially helpful in preventing drought stress during Northeast Ohio’s hot summers.” url=”” target=”_self” align=”inherit,;,,;,,;,,;,” size=”normal,;,,;,,;,,;,” style=”borderless” shape=”circle” color_scheme=”” title_size=”normal” title_weight=”” responsive=”” publish_datetime=”” expiry_datetime=”” el_id=”” el_class=”” el_style=”” text_color_scheme=”” animation=”no_animation”][/bt_bb_service][bt_bb_separator top_spacing=”,;,,;,,;,,;,” bottom_spacing=”small,;,,;,,;,,;,” border_style=”none” border_width=”” responsive=”” publish_datetime=”” expiry_datetime=”” el_id=”” el_class=”” el_style=”” animation=”no_animation”][/bt_bb_separator][bt_bb_separator top_spacing=”,;,,;,,;,,;,” bottom_spacing=”small,;,,;,,;,,;,” border_style=”none” border_width=”” responsive=”” publish_datetime=”” expiry_datetime=”” el_id=”” el_class=”” el_style=”” animation=”no_animation”][/bt_bb_separator][bt_bb_separator top_spacing=”,;,,;,,;,,;,” bottom_spacing=”small,;,,;,,;,,;,” border_style=”none” border_width=”” responsive=”” publish_datetime=”” expiry_datetime=”” el_id=”” el_class=”” el_style=”” animation=”no_animation”][/bt_bb_separator][/bt_bb_column][/bt_bb_row][/bt_bb_section][bt_bb_section layout=”boxed_1200″ top_spacing=”large,;,,;,,;,,;,” bottom_spacing=”large,;,,;,,;,,;,” full_screen=”” vertical_align=”top” color_scheme=”dark-skin” background_color=”” background_image=”4528″ background_overlay=”dark_solid” parallax=”2″ parallax_offset=”” background_video_yt=”” yt_video_settings=”” background_video_mp4=”” background_video_ogg=”” background_video_webm=”” responsive=”” publish_datetime=”” expiry_datetime=”” el_id=”” el_class=”” el_style=”” lazy_load=”no” bt_bb_toggled=”true” parallax_zoom_start=”” parallax_zoom_end=”” parallax_blur_start=”” parallax_blur_end=”” parallax_opacity_start=”” parallax_opacity_end=”” top_section_coverage_image=”” bottom_section_coverage_image=”” show_video_on_mobile=”” animation=”no_animation”][bt_bb_row][bt_bb_column width=”1/2″ align=”center” vertical_align=”top” animation=”fade_in” padding=”normal” background_image=”” inner_background_image=”” background_color=”” inner_background_color=”” opacity=”” responsive=”” publish_datetime=”” expiry_datetime=”” el_id=”” el_class=”” el_style=”” style=”” width_lg=”1/2″ width_md=”1/2″ width_sm=”1/2″ width_xs=”1/1″][bt_bb_headline font_subset=”latin,latin-ext” superheadline=”Step 2:” headline=”Regularly Introduce New Grass Seed” subheadline=”Overseeding is essential for keeping your lawn thick, lush, and vibrant. This involves identifying thin or patchy areas, bare spots, and parts of the lawn that show signs of stress. For Lyndhurst homeowners, where yards often feature a mix of sun and shade due to mature trees, it’s especially important to analyze how much sunlight each area receives. Grass in sunny spots may dry out faster and benefit from sun-tolerant seed varieties, while shaded areas require specialized blends to thrive.

We also take factors like soil drainage, slope, and compaction into account. Lyndhurst’s clay-heavy soil can be prone to drainage issues and may require aeration or soil amendments before overseeding to ensure the best seed-to-soil contact. In Lyndhurst, where yards often face a mix of sunny and shaded conditions, we tailor seed blends to fit your lawn’s specific needs. Sun-loving varieties like Kentucky bluegrass are ideal for open, sunny areas, while shade-tolerant fescues thrive under mature trees. Aeration involves creating small holes in the soil to break up compaction and improve the flow of water, air, and nutrients to the roots. In Lyndhurst, where clay-heavy soil is common, compaction can easily occur from regular foot traffic and natural settling. Aeration is essential to loosen the soil, promote deeper root growth, and create a healthier, more resilient lawn that can withstand stress and seasonal changes.

How often should I aerate my lawn?

For most Northeast Ohio lawns, aeration is recommended once or twice a year, typically in the spring and fall. Lawns with heavy traffic or compacted soil may benefit from more frequent aeration to keep them healthy and thriving.

Compacted soil can be identified by several signs, such as water pooling on the surface after rain, difficulty pushing a shovel into the ground, or grass that appears thin and weak. In Lyndhurst, where clay-heavy soil is common, lawns may feel particularly hard underfoot and struggle to absorb water or nutrients effectively. If your grass doesn’t respond well to watering or fertilization, it’s a strong indication that your soil may need aeration.

Soil pH plays a critical role in how effectively your grass absorbs nutrients. In areas like Lyndhurst, where soil can often lean acidic, balancing pH with treatments like lime may be necessary. Maintaining a pH level between 6.0 and 7.0 ensures your lawn has the ideal conditions to grow thick, green, and healthy, supporting strong root development and overall resilience.

Lawns in Lyndhurst benefit from grass seed varieties that can thrive in Northeast Ohio’s seasonal extremes, from cold winters to humid summers. Kentucky bluegrass is a popular choice for its durability and vibrant color, while perennial ryegrass germinates quickly, making it ideal for filling bare spots. Fine fescue is perfect for shaded areas, which are common in neighborhoods with mature trees. Using a tailored mix of these varieties ensures your lawn stays thick, healthy, and resilient all year long.

The time it takes for new grass seed to grow depends on the type of seed and your lawn’s conditions. In most cases, grass seed will germinate within 5–10 days, and you’ll see visible growth in about 2–3 weeks. Full establishment, where the grass thickens and develops strong roots, usually takes 6–8 weeks. Caring for new grass seed after overseeding is crucial to its success. Water your lawn lightly and consistently to keep the soil moist but not oversaturated during the germination phase. Avoid mowing until the new grass reaches about 3–4 inches tall to prevent damage to the young blades. The best times to overseed a lawn in Lyndhurst, like the rest of Northeast Ohio, are in the spring (April–May) and fall (September–October). These seasons provide the perfect balance of warm soil temperatures and natural moisture, creating optimal conditions for seed germination. Fall is often the preferred time, as it gives the new grass plenty of time to establish strong roots before winter sets in, ensuring a thicker, healthier lawn come spring.

New grass seed requires consistent watering to germinate and grow successfully. In the first few weeks, water your lawn lightly 1–2 times per day to keep the top layer of soil evenly moist without over-saturating it. As the grass begins to grow and reaches about 2–3 inches tall, transition to deeper, less frequent watering to encourage strong root development. For Lyndhurst lawns, proper watering is especially important to balance the needs of areas with varying sun exposure or clay-heavy soil.

Pro Tip:  Timing matters—early morning is the best time to water, as it minimizes evaporation and reduces the risk of fungal diseases.

Walking on a freshly overseeded lawn can displace the seeds and compact the soil, making it harder for the grass to grow. We recommend giving the young grass a little time to establish itself—at least until it’s about 3–4 inches tall. If you absolutely must walk on it, consider tiptoeing or using planks to spread out the weight. Your lawn (and your future self) will thank you!

Dog Owners: Dogs and other pets should also be kept off newly seeded lawns to prevent disturbance. Consider overseeding in sections throughout the year so you can block off areas while they get established.

Will birds eat your grass seed? Absolutely—they think you’ve set up an all-you-can-eat buffet just for them. While some seed loss to birds is inevitable, there are ways to minimize it. After overseeding, we recommend lightly raking or top-dressing the lawn with a thin layer of soil or compost to help cover the seeds and discourage feathered visitors. Watering immediately after seeding also helps stick the seeds in place. If you have heavy bird activity in your Lyndhurst yard, biodegradable seed mats or netting can add an extra layer of protection. Don’t worry—your lawn will still come out on top!

For optimal lawn health, it’s important to never cut more than one-third of the grass blade at a time. Removing too much at once can stress the grass, weaken the roots, and leave the lawn more susceptible to heat, drought, and disease.

Another key to healthy mowing is varying the direction or path each week. This not only gives your lawn that clean checkerboard or diamond look but also helps the grass grow upright and prevents soil compaction caused by repeatedly mowing the same areas.

Additionally, we avoid mowing during extreme heatwaves or when the lawn is wet. Mowing in extreme heat can shock the grass, causing it to dry out and turn brown, while cutting wet grass can lead to clumping, uneven cuts, and compacted soil. Yes, we regularly change mowing patterns to protect your lawn and enhance its appearance. Mowing in the same direction week after week can cause soil compaction, create unsightly ruts, and lead to grass growing in a slanted direction. Over time, this weakens the grass fibers, making your lawn more susceptible to stress, disease, and uneven growth.

Rotating mowing patterns—such as alternating between horizontal, vertical, and diagonal passes—not only prevents these issues but also helps the grass grow upright and evenly. In most cases, it’s beneficial to leave grass clippings on your lawn—a practice known as “grasscycling.” Clippings decompose quickly, returning valuable nutrients, especially nitrogen, to the soil. This natural fertilization can supply up to 25% of your lawn’s annual nitrogen needs, reducing the requirement for additional fertilizers.

However, there are exceptions:

  • Spring Growth: During periods of rapid growth in spring, mowing may produce excessive clippings that form clumps on the lawn. These clumps can smother grass and contribute to thatch buildup. In such cases, bagging the clippings is advisable to maintain lawn health.

  • Composting: If you maintain a compost pile for your garden, bagging clippings occasionally provides a rich nitrogen source for compost. However, it’s important to balance this by leaving clippings on the lawn at other times to continue nourishing it naturally.
  • Leaf Management in Fall: In the fall, bagging clippings along with fallen leaves can be an effective way to clear debris and prevent potential fungal issues. Alternatively, mulching leaves into smaller pieces and leaving them on the lawn can also enrich the soil.

By thoughtfully managing grass clippings based on seasonal conditions and specific lawn needs, you can enhance your lawn’s health and reduce dependency on chemical fertilizers.

During periods of drought or extreme heat, we adjust our lawn care practices to prioritize the long-term health of your lawn. One key adjustment is raising the mowing height to help the grass retain moisture and reduce stress. Grass that is cut too short during these conditions is more likely to dry out and weaken.

If temperatures exceed 90°F, we refrain from mowing altogether, as mowing during extreme heat can shock the grass and cause long-term damage. Seasonal lawn care is essential to keeping your lawn healthy and resilient throughout the year, as each season brings its own challenges and needs.

  • Spring: We kick off the season with a thorough cleanup to remove debris like leaves and sticks left over from winter. This allows sunlight and nutrients to reach the grass. Mowing begins early, often at a slightly lower height to manage rapid growth. We also apply fertilizers to jumpstart the lawn’s recovery and encourage healthy new growth. Weed prevention treatments may be applied to tackle early-season weeds before they establish.

  • Summer: As the temperatures rise, we adjust mowing heights to help the lawn retain moisture and avoid stress from heat. Weed control remains a focus, especially as invasive species thrive in warm weather. We provide watering recommendations, emphasizing deep, infrequent watering to encourage strong root development. If necessary, we may skip mowing during extreme heat but focus on edging and light trimming to keep your lawn tidy.
  • Fall: This is the prime time for overseeding and aeration, as soil temperatures are warm and rainfall increases, creating the perfect conditions for new grass to establish. We also begin gradually lowering mowing heights to prepare the lawn for dormancy. Leaf management, either through mulching or bagging, ensures debris doesn’t smother the grass. Fertilizers are applied to strengthen the roots before winter.
  • Winter: While the grass lies dormant, we focus on keeping the lawn clear of heavy debris that could lead to disease or damage. Snow mold prevention and proper end-of-season mowing techniques (shorter grass height) set the stage for a successful start to spring.

Preventing weeds starts with creating an environment where grass can outcompete them naturally. Our approach focuses on proactive, long-term care rather than relying solely on chemicals.

The foundation of weed prevention is maintaining a healthy, dense lawn. We achieve this by mowing at the correct height—typically 3–4 inches—to shade out weed seeds and prevent them from germinating. Regular fertilization ensures the grass has the nutrients it needs to grow thick and strong, making it harder for weeds to take hold. Overseeding is another essential step we take to fill bare spots and maintain lawn density, which reduces open areas where weeds can thrive.

For weeds that do appear, we use targeted control methods designed to eliminate them without harming your grass or the environment.
